Transaction

86cc4a4058184ea07210f680080d556e084a4432db7d23a2bf4fa432d0329008

Summary

In Block269030
TimeFri, 14 Jul 2023 19:23:00 UTC
Total Input2424.72850029 Nebula
Total Output2424.72843669 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
634373 Confirmations2424.72843669 Nebula
Raw Transaction